SBP Aims to Strengthen Organizational Leadership

Friday, 29 August 2025

The Superintendency of Banks of Panama (SBP), in partnership with Great Place to Work®, held the workshop “The Strategic Role of the Leader in Business and Culture” as part of its institutional and cultural strengthening strategy.

The session featured a keynote presentation by Paulo César Preciado, Executive Advisor Partner at Great Place to Work® for the Caribbean, Central America, and Mexico, who shared key insights on building an organizational culture rooted in trust and collaboration.

The workshop’s main objective was to provide SBP leaders with methodological tools to prioritize immediate actions that address the organization’s current challenges, while fostering a high-trust culture at both the individual and group levels, based on Great Place to Work®’s Giftwork® model.

Throughout the day, participants engaged in discussions on essential topics such as:

· The nine practice areas for building great workplaces.
· How top leaders drive their strategies through leadership.
· Authentic collaboration and the active role of each leader.
· Prioritizing key areas and designing impactful actions that exceed expectations.

With initiatives like this, SBP reaffirms its commitment to developing human talent, strengthening internal leadership, and fostering a sustainable organizational culture.
